Analysis
The most recent figure for fossil fuel consumption, per square kilometre in Croatia is 0.0013 terawatt-hours per square kilometre, measured in 2023.
The figure is up 5.6% on the previous year and up 3.4% over ten years.
Over the whole period, fossil fuel consumption, per square kilometre in Croatia peaked at 0.0017 terawatt-hours per square kilometre in 2007 and was at its lowest, 0.0012 terawatt-hours per square kilometre, in 2020.
Croatia ranks 82nd of 205 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.
The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 32 years of available data.

How this figure is calculated
Fossil fuel consumption divided by Land area (sq. km), matched on country and year. Neither publisher issues this ratio as a series; it is computed here from both.
Fossil fuel consumption ÷ Land area (sq. km)
Computed from
- Fossil fuel consumption Energy Institute - Statistical Review of World Energy (2026) and other sources – with major processing by Our World in Data
- Land area FAOSTAT, Food and Agriculture Organization of the United Nations (FAO)
Statizoid computes this series; the underlying measurements belong to the publishers named above. The arithmetic is applied to every country and year where both inputs report, and nothing is estimated unless the page says so.
